> no-arg constructor of /org/apache/hadoop/conf/Configured calls setConf(null). This is unnecessary and it increases complexity of setConf() code because you have to check for not null object reference before using it. Under normal conditions setConf() is never called with null reference, so not null check is unnecessary.
